Cheesy Ranch Potatoes And Sausage Recipe

  • Total Time: 4 hours 15 minutes
  • Yield: 6 1x

Ingredients

Scale

Main Ingredients:

  • 1 pound (454 grams) smoked sausage, sliced
  • 1 regular size bag of frozen shredded hash browns
  • 2 bell peppers, sliced
  • 1 onion, diced

Dairy and Creamy Components:

  • 1 cup (240 milliliters) shredded cheese
  • 3/4 cup (180 milliliters) heavy whipping cream
  • 1/2 cup (120 milliliters) sour cream
  • 1 can cheddar cheese soup

Seasoning:

  • 1 packet ranch seasoning

Instructions

  1. Heat a skillet over medium-high temperature and caramelize the smoked sausage with bell peppers and onions, releasing their rich aromatics and developing a golden-brown exterior.
  2. Transfer the sautéed mixture into a slow cooker, creating a flavorful base for the dish.
  3. Add frozen hash browns to the crockpot, ensuring even distribution throughout the mixture.
  4. Pour heavy whipping cream, cheddar cheese soup, and sour cream into the slow cooker, creating a luxurious and creamy foundation.
  5. Sprinkle ranch seasoning packet across the ingredients, infusing the dish with tangy and herbaceous notes.
  6. Generously incorporate shredded cheese, which will melt and bind the components together during cooking.
  7. Thoroughly mix all ingredients until they are uniformly combined, guaranteeing balanced flavor in every bite.
  8. Cover the crockpot and set to high heat for 2 hours or low heat for 4 hours, allowing the potatoes to become tender and the cheese to transform into a velvety sauce.
  9. After cooking, gently stir the mixture to integrate the melted cheese and ensure consistent texture.
  10. Serve piping hot, presenting a comforting one-pot meal that marries smoky sausage with creamy, zesty elements.

Notes

  • Enhance flavor by sautéing sausage and vegetables before adding to crockpot for deeper, more complex taste profiles.
  • Customize protein by swapping smoked sausage with chicken, turkey sausage, or vegetarian alternatives for dietary preferences.
  • Reduce calories by using low-fat cheese, Greek yogurt instead of sour cream, and low-sodium ranch seasoning for healthier version.
  • Prevent sticking by lightly spraying crockpot with cooking spray or using a crockpot liner for easier cleanup and serving.
